Thanks bigli, I got an opinion from virka that the total number of months outside Finland in the last 2 years should not be more than 6 months.

Can you also get the same interpretation from the below link?

http://www.migri.fi/finnish_citizenship ... de_finland

"The following periods of absence will not interrupt your continuous period of residence:

absences that last a maximum of one month
a maximum of six periods of absence that last 1–2 months each
a maximum of two periods of absence that last 2–6 months each
If you are temporarily absent from Finland for over six months but no longer than one year, your continuous period of residence will not be interrupted. However, the period of absence is not counted as continuous residential time."

If you are absent from Finland for longer than one year, your periods of residence in Finland will be taken into account as an accumulated period of residence."

What is the interpretation of above underlined text in green font i.e. which of these (A/B) is true?:
A) The maximum time for one trip cannot be more than 6 months.
or
B) The total of all the trips in the last 2 years cannot be more than 6 months.


The advisor in the virka said interpretation is (A), but then page does not say this explicitly, hence the confusion.
Please give your interpretation A or B or something else?
